Analysis
The most recent figure for current account balance as a share of gdp in Malaysia is 1.7%, measured in 2024.
The figure is up 8.3% on the previous year and down 61.5% over ten years.
Over the whole period, current account balance as a share of gdp in Malaysia peaked at 16.9% in 2008 and was at its lowest, 1.6%, in 2023.
Malaysia ranks 66th of 193 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 12.6% | 7.1% | 16.9% | 10 |
| 2010s | 4.8% | 2.2% | 10.9% | 10 |
| 2020s | 2.9% | 1.6% | 4.2% | 5 |
